    31 T provides a worst case required thickness for nozzle analysis for a nozzle located on the large end of the cone and located

    32 on the long seam weld.

    33 The UG-16(b) minimum thickness requirement has not been taken into consideration here.

    34 Discontinuity checks which are required for each end of the cone when it is welded to a straight shell are not included

    35 in this sheet.

    36 This sheet cannot be used to check for allowable exterior pressure loads.

    37 This sheet is for educational use only - use at your own risk.
